A LATE VICTORIAN COALBROOKDALE PAINTED 'DOG' STICK-STAND
LAST QUARTER 19TH CENTURY
The begging terrier with a staff with entwined cord in his mouth on a pierced pedestal with an oval foliate drip-pan to the front, stamped on the underside indistinctly with a registered design mark and ..8598 (?)
23 in. (58.5 cm.) high; 20½ in. (52 cm.) wide; 12½ in. (32 cm.) deep (2)
